Trackpad click inop in OS X Mavericks Recovery HD

When launching in the Recovery HD mode, my click on the trackpad does not work and I am unable to select a Disk Utility.  Product data: Macbook, Late 2008 running OS Mavericks 10.9.4.  Thanks for any help.

By "clicking", do you mean the actual physical click on the trackpad (physically pressing the bottom edge of the trackpad down, triggering it that way for a hardware-based "click") or a "tap" of the trackpad (lightly tapping the trackpad) for a software-based click?
If you are tapping the trackpad, this doesn't work in recovery...you need to physically click on the trackpad (hardware-based "click")
If you are physically clicking the trackpad (not tapping) and you are not getting the clicks to register, you can try resetting the SMC:
Intel-based Macs: Resetting the System Management Controller (SMC)

  • When I click on free upgrade to Mavericks it says 'we could not complete your purchase, The product distribution file could not be verified. It may be damaged or was not signed.' What should I do? Thanks

    When I click on free upgrade to Mavericks it says 'we could not complete your purchase, The product distribution file could not be verified. It may be damaged or was not signed.' What should I do? Thanks

    Several causes for this problem have been reported. Please take each of the following steps that you haven't already tried. Stop when it's resolved.
    Step 1
    If possible, test on another network, such as a public hotspot (if the computer is portable) or the hotspot created by a mobile device. A network gateway that blocks some traffic, most likely on a company or university network, could be causing the error.
    Step 2
    Back up all data.
    From the menu bar, select
               ▹ System Preferences... ▹ Network
    If the preference pane is locked, click the lock icon in the lower left corner and enter your password to unlock it. Then click the Advanced button and select the Proxies tab. If any proxy options are selected, make a note of them and then deselect them. You don’t need to change the bypass or FTP settings. Click OK and then Apply. Test. The result may be that you can't connect to any web server. Restore the previous settings if that happens.
    Step 3
    Rebuild the Spotlight index. If you try to search now from the magnifying-glass icon in the top right corner of the display, there will be an indication that indexing is in progress.
    Step 4
    Start up in safe mode and log in to the account with the problem. You must hold down the shift key twice: once when you turn on the computer, and again when you log in.
    Note: If FileVault is enabled, or if a firmware password is set, or if the startup volume is a software RAID, you can’t do this. Ask for further instructions.
    Safe mode is much slower to start and run than normal, with limited graphics performance, and some things won’t work at all, including sound output and Wi-Fi on certain models. The next normal startup may also be somewhat slow.
    The login screen appears even if you usually login automatically. You must know your login password in order to log in. If you’ve forgotten the password, you will need to reset it before you begin.
    Test while in safe mode. Same problem?
    After testing, restart as usual (not in safe mode) and verify that you still have the problem. Post the results of the test.

  • My trackpad click doesn't register.

    Hi there,
    I have a 13" MacBook Pro, and it's trackpad click doesn't seem to be registering. Whenever I try to click on something, nothing happens. But I don't think it's a hardware problem, because as I have tap to click enabled, I would expect this to still register, which it doesn't. Also whenever I hover over something that should return something else on hover, say an item in the dock, nothing happens. I've tried restarting, and resetting the SMC to no avail. I am running 10.8.2. Has anyone else heard of this issue, or better yet, know how to fix it?
    Thanks,
    Sam

    Is it actually.... CLICKING?
    A known issue with these buttonless trackpads that are actually a huge button is that debris gets trapped in the minuscule gap between the pad and the aluminum chassis or topcase. Hence, the pad goes down, gets stuck and never comes back up. Then comes the nightmare of trying to locate and remove the obstruction without demolishing the device, lest you end up having to repair it The Apple Way: by replacing the whole topcase to the tune of lots of money.
    So, is this your case?

  • Trackpad Click in Boot Camp

    Just installed Leopard on MPB 2.2 Santa Rosa. Trackpad Click does not work (tapping on the trackpad to select). Anyone know a fix? Thanks.

    Yeah this really urks me that the tap-click doesn't work. I've got WinXP SP2 running on my Macbook Pro. It's really frustrating that they don't enable this, but maybe I don't know the whole story.
    Also, another feature not enabled in Windows is to ignore accidental trackpad touching. In Mac OS X, there is an option in the trackpad preferences to ignore accidental input. Basically it tries to eliminate any unintended trackpad touches e.g. your palms tapping it while you type. In boot camp, this doesn't work. Which is a HUGE problem in Windows for me because that's pretty much all I do is type.
